About Kumar Akash

Kumar Akash is a scholar working on Social Psychology, Automotive Engineering, Safety, Risk, Reliability and Quality, Cognitive Neuroscience and Surgery, having authored 39 papers that have together received 478 indexed citations. Recurring topics across this work include Human-Automation Interaction and Safety (26 papers), Traffic and Road Safety (10 papers), Autonomous Vehicle Technology and Safety (6 papers), Safety Warnings and Signage (6 papers), Transportation and Mobility Innovations (6 papers), Healthcare Technology and Patient Monitoring (5 papers), EEG and Brain-Computer Interfaces (4 papers) and Older Adults Driving Studies (3 papers). The work is most often cited by research in Social Psychology (330 citations), Radiological and Ultrasound Technology (39 citations), Safety Research (56 citations), Safety, Risk, Reliability and Quality (58 citations) and Automotive Engineering (66 citations). Kumar Akash has collaborated with scholars based in United States and India. Frequent co-authors include Neera Jain, Tahira Reid, Wan-Lin Hu, Teruhisa Misu, Sujitha Martin, Linda Ng Boyle, Carlos Busso, Na Du, Jorge Ortiz and Gaojian Huang. Their work appears in journals such as IEEE Transactions on Human-Machine Systems, International Journal of Human-Computer Interaction, Frontiers in Psychology, IEEE Control Systems and Human Factors The Journal of the Human Factors and Ergonomics Society.
